Chicken Tinola. Chicken Tinola is a Filipino soup dish. It involves cooking chicken pieces in ginger broth. Tinola is traditionally cooked with wedges of unripe papaya and malunggay leaves.

Chicken Tinola

Tinola is a Filipino chicken soup usually served as an appetizer or a main entrée with white rice. Traditionally, this dish is cooked with chicken, wedges of green papaya, and leaves of the siling labuyo chili pepper in broth flavored with ginger, onions and fish sauce.. Ingredients of Chicken Tinola

  1. It's 1/2 of k chicken (with bones) chopped.
  2. It's 2 cups of dahon ng sili/chili leaves or malunggay.
  3. Prepare 2 of chayote peeled and sliced or 2 unripe green papaya wedges.
  4. Prepare 8 cups of water.
  5. You need 4 cloves of garlic minced.
  6. It's 1 of medium sized onion diced.
  7. It's 1 of garlic peeled and julienned.
  8. It's 1 of chicken broth cube.
  9. Prepare 2 tablespoons of fish sauce.
  10. You need of Cooking oil.
  11. It's to taste of Salt and pepper.

Chicken Tinola step by step

  1. Saute ginger in oil for about 2 minutes. Add garlic and onions. Cook until garlic is golden brown and onions are translucent. Set aside. Using the same pan cook chicken for about 10 minutes until sides have slightly browned. (I like my chicken cooked in oil and slightly browned, although you don't need to do this as we will still cook the chicken in boiling water)..
  2. In a pot with water and medium heat/fire, transfer sauteed garlic, onion, ginger, slightly browned chicken, and add chayote or green papaya. Bring to a boil. Add chicken broth cube, fish sauce, salt and pepper. Cook for 20-30 minutes or until chicken is done and chayote or papaya is tender..
  3. Turn heat to low and add dahon ng sili/chili tops or malunggay leaves. Simmer for 2 minutes and turn off heat. Serve with steamed rice and enjoy!.
